PICO® II Very Fast-Acting Subminiature Axial Leaded Fuse

Brand: Littelfuse, Inc

The PICO® II Very Fast-Acting Fuse is designed to meet an extensive array of performance characteristics in a space-saving subminiature package.
Features
  • Very fast-acting
  • Small Size
  • Wide current rating range (62mA- 15A)
  • RoHS compliant 
  • Halogen-free available 
  • Wide operating temperature range
  • Low temperature rerating

Specifications

Materials

  • Encapsulated, Epoxy-Coated Body
  • 251 Series: Pure tin-Coated Copper wire leads
  • 253 Series: Solder-Coated Copper wire leads

Solderability

  • MIL-STD-202, Method 208

Lead Pull Force

  • MIL-STD-202, Method 211, Test Condition A (will withstand a 7 lb axial pull test)

Fuses to MIL SPEC

  • For fuses to MIL-PRF-23419, FM10 change the series number from 251 to 253

Operating Temperature

  • -55° to +125° C (Consider re-rating)

Vibration

  • MIL-STD-202, Method 201 (10-55 Hz), Method 204, Test Condition C (55-2000 Hz at 10 G’s Peak)

Shock

  • MIL-STD-202, Method 213, Test Condition I (100 G’s peak for 6 msecs.)

Insulation Resistance (After Opening)

  • MIL-STD-202, Method 302, Test Condition A (10,000 ohms minimum at 100 volts)

Moisture Resistance

  • MIL-STD-202, Method 106

Resistance to Soldering Heat

  • Withstands 60 seconds above 200OC and up to 260° C, Max.

Flammability Rating

  • UL 94V-0
